Ben Chilwell defender feels positive after successful knee surgery
Chelsea's left defender Ben Chilwell says he is "optimistic" following a successful operation to repair a knee ligament problem.
The 25-year-old sustained an anterior cruciate ligament injury during the second half of Blues' 4-0 Champions League victory over
Juventusat Stamford Bridge.
The England international may miss the remainder of the season for
Chelsea, but his ligament repair procedure has provided a welcome boost.
posted on
Twitteron Thursday
: "Just wanted to let everyone know that the operation yesterday was successful.
"I feel very positive & motivated to work like a beast to get back on the pitch with my boys soon and help this great club win more trophies.
"Thank you all for the support and nice messages."
